Bean to Coffee Machines

A bean-to-coffee machine is a machine commercial which automatically grinds beans and dispenses milk-based drinks like cappuccino and Latte. They also texturize milk to produce creamy drinks. No training for staff is required to operate them.

They have pre-sets which allow you to save and modify the coffee settings to ensure that your employees and customers get a delicious cup of coffee every time.

Cost

The cost of a bean to cup coffee machines with milk frother (sources) to coffee maker can vary in price, but it's usually more expensive than a pod-based model. It's more expensive because it grinds and prepares the beans before brewing. It also comes with more sophisticated features, like milk frothing capabilities. However, it can save money in the long run by eliminating the need for regular purchases of coffee pods.

With a bean-to-cup machine you'll also save money on coffee-related equipment as many models come with built-in grinders as well as milk-steamers. You can also find some models which are smaller, making them more suitable for those who have little space. In addition, a bean-to-cup device can be greener since it reduces coffee waste and avoids the necessity of prepackaged pods.

One of the primary benefits of machine beans-to-cup is their ability to create a variety of drinks, including espressos, lattes, cappuccinos and flat whites. These machines are designed to operate without the need for training for staff and can be equipped with pre-programmed drink options. This is perfect for restaurants and bars, because baristas can focus on other things while coffee is being brewed.

A bean-to-cup machine will also grind the proper amount of beans per cup. This ensures that every cup of coffee has the same flavor and aroma. It can also eliminate problems that may arise with pod-based or preground coffee like improper pressure tamping or inconsistent extraction.

While the initial purchase of a bean-to-cup coffee machine might be more expensive than a pod-based machine, it can save money over the long term. Coffee beans are generally less expensive than pods of coffee and a machine that is bean-to-cup will eliminate the ongoing cost of compatible capsules.

Additionally, the majority of models of bean-to-cup coffee machines are designed to be simple to maintain and clean. They're generally more efficient in cleaning and descaling than pod-based models, and they can detect on their own when they require a more thorough clean or descale. Some models will even remind you to perform these tasks. However, it is important to read the manufacturer's instructions carefully, as using non-compatible descaling products or cleaning solutions could void your warranty.

Convenience

Bean to cup machines can be a wonderful convenience for home and in the workplace. They can save time and money by removing the need for pods and other coffee waste. They also produce beautiful consistent cups of coffee without the need for training for staff. This is especially useful for bars and restaurants where staff members are pressured to make coffee. In addition, these smart machines let customers choose their own drink recipes and modify the strength of their coffee.

They also remove the need for a separate mill, which can save both space and money. They have a built-in grinder that grinds whole beans on demand, giving the best taste and aroma. They also have the ability to cook and texturize milk on demand to make a variety of drinks, including cappuccinos lattes, and flat whites.

The primary benefit of a bean-to-cup machine is that it eliminates the requirement for paper filters as well as coffee pods. This helps reduce waste and save on replacement costs, making them a more eco-friendly option than traditional coffee machines. The fact that these machines only grind the exact amount of beans needed for a specific drink recipe also means that there isn't any coffee wastage.

These fully automatic machines will aid businesses in reducing their impact on the environment. By decreasing the amount of waste they generate Bean-to-cup machines can save businesses up to $120 per month in the US.

This technology is gaining popularity in the retail sector as well and there is a growing number of convenience stores including them in their menus. They provide premium services to customers, and can increase the sales of other products like soft drinks and snacks.

Although they're more expensive than pod machines, bean-to cup machines have a higher upfront cost, so it's important to understand the best bean to cup coffee machines financial benefits and risks before purchasing one. These machines are typically lease on a monthly basis, making them an excellent choice for small businesses. This is also an excellent way to test out the machine before purchasing it for the long term.

A wide variety of coffees

Bean to cup machines are not restricted to a limited number of flavors like pod machines. They can offer unlimited combinations. These machines grind whole coffee beans and then brew the brew into the cup you prefer and give you the same experience as barista made drinks. This is perfect for those who prefer to make drinks using fresh top-quality ingredients. The machine allows you to take pleasure in different flavors like hot tea and chocolate.

Bean-to-cup coffee machines have an advantage over pod-based coffee machines because they do not use disposable plastic capsules. This is a consideration that you should take into account if your office is concerned about the amount of coffee it consumes. Bean-to-cup machines typically use ground coffee instead of pods pre-packaged. They generate less waste.

Additionally the machines can be used with different beans, from standard varieties to more exotic ones. There are a myriad of choices available, ranging from the well-known Blue Mountain Jamaican to the more obscure Kopi Luwak (a type of coffee that has passed through the digestive tract of the Asian Palm Civet). These machines are easy to operate and produce many different coffees.

The coffee machines are also equipped with an internal grinder, which ensures that the coffee is freshly brewed every time. They also have the ability to automatically grind beans to a proper consistency. This makes the machine more efficient than a manual grinder and allows you to manage the best bean to cup coffee machines strength of your coffee. In addition it can be programmed to dispense a certain amount of water based upon the coffee you select.

Modern bean-to cup machines can be connected to the internet so you can access them from any location. This is particularly useful in offices where employees are constantly on the move and cannot be present to brew coffee. This feature can increase employee satisfaction and productivity at work.

Despite the cost increase upfront, bean-to-cup machines could help you save money over time by reducing the expense of barista-made coffees. In addition, they are easier to maintain than pod-based coffee machines.

Maintenance

Bean-to-cup machines produce drinks with fresh milk and beans, unlike pod machines. They also have the benefit of making drinks with a greater taste. They could be more expensive to run, as they require a larger initial investment. These machines also need regular maintenance and cleaning to ensure they are operating properly. Inability to keep the machine clean can result in problems with taste, and can also lead to an accumulation of bacteria in tubes and pipes.

To prevent this from happening it is essential to clean the coffee maker on a regular basis. Arfize is the best commercial descaler to use. White vinegar is not suitable for this job, since the acid can cause damage to the seals and other parts of the machine. In addition, it is important to do a backflush once every two weeks. This is important as it eliminates any milk residues that could have accumulated in the pipes and tubes.

Weekly, you should also clean the brewing area and milk nozzles. This is to ensure that the machine is free of limescale and other stains, and it will prevent blockages from occurring in the future. It's also a great idea to perform a complete descaling process every month. This will help to stop blockages, maintain an excellent hygiene level and ensure that you are meeting the health and safety standards.
